The Design Of The Wild Information System Based On Microcomputer

As global climate changes, now countries climate and environment greatly affected, where the climate particularly the temperature and humidity has a great influence on the growth of forest vegetation, animal habitats and breeding.For a clearer understanding of wild perennial condition of temperature and humidity, needing a cheap, portable, reliable and a long-term and effective real-time data acquisition system for real-time monitoring.This thesis mainly content is a wild information system, it via the GPRS data transmission mode use the PC to remote control terminal machine MCU for acquisit temperature and humidity data.This system using PIC single chip microcomputer to control the temperature and humidity sensors according to the sampling interval set by the data acquisition, can also choose to manually click the button of data center control interface on a PC computer to collect data, acquisition of data sent to the PC through GPRS, at the same time PIC single chip microcontroller will take the collected data stored in the SD card in order to the later analysis and research conveniently, it is the battery power supply mode to realize low energy consumption of a data acquisition system.PIC single chip microcontroller is choosed for the lower machine of this system, it features shown in the development is easy, the cycle is short, the program perform faster, low power consumption, high performance to price ratio characteristics and so on.Microcontroller connected with intelligent digital temperature sensor DS18B20and humidity sensor HIH3610, coupled with the data storage SD card form of the whole system’s data acquisition terminal, can achieve the function of temperature and humidity data mass storage over a long period of time.Single-chip computer connect with GPRS module through RS-232to achieve the field information remote control via GPRS wireless network and Interne.In the PC using VC software interface display the corresponding graphic data, realize the remote monitoring of the field information.With these the whole system has realized the design of the wild information system based on single chip microcomputer.Because the GPRS has high transmission rate, short access time, provide real-time online function, according to how much flow to billing and such as performance characteristics.Collecting module of PIC single chip features, low power consumption makes the whole system characterized cheap, easy to carry, reliable operation, so that it can unattended for a long time of a miniature power remote control system.
